I just came back from this movie, and well, it's great. One of the top 10 films I saw this year, and Kevin Bacon really deserves an oscar nomination (which he didn't get). I can see why he didn't get it (the subject matter is not oscar material), but still, it's one of the best performances this year. If you think American movies are too much filled with saccharine or aren't serious enough, see this movie. It's a very well made character study, and it's tightly written, without any unexplored thread or useless meandering. Every actor in the movie does a great job.
